Tesla absorbed a $112 million after-tax impairment loss on its Bitcoin holdings last quarter, and the latest Bitcoin price prediction debate centers on whether its decision to hold reflects conviction or patience. Bitcoin is currently trading around $66,500, down about 0.6% over the past 24 hours. That question could shape sentiment more than many investors expect.

According to Tesla’s Q2 earnings release, the company still held 11,509 BTC. That is the same position it has maintained since selling roughly 75% of its original stake in 2022. The impairment charge followed Bitcoin’s sharp decline during Q2, although Tesla kept its treasury untouched throughout the quarter.

Meanwhile, Tesla’s earnings delivered mixed results. Non-GAAP EPS came in at $0.33, missing the $0.55 consensus estimate. However, revenue reached $28.2 billion, beating expectations of $27.6 billion. Even so, the company made no changes to its Bitcoin holdings despite the earnings miss.

Tesla’s steady approach stands out because it remains one of the largest publicly traded corporate Bitcoin holders. Meanwhile, Bitcoin continues consolidating near the $66,000 level, where traders are watching for the next breakout. If momentum returns, Tesla’s decision to hold could strengthen the long-term bullish narrative.

Bitcoin Price Prediction: Can BTC Break Above $70,000 as Institutional Holders Stand Pat?

Bitcoin is trading around $66,500 at the time of writing, holding inside a consolidation range that has shaped recent Bitcoin price prediction outlooks. The recent swing low near $58,000 remains a key support zone after absorbing heavy selling pressure. Meanwhile, resistance sits near the low $80,000s, where sellers previously regained control.

For now, the $60,000 to $66,500 range suggests steady accumulation instead of aggressive buying. Trading volume has recovered gradually, showing less panic selling but limited breakout conviction. Even so, the moving average structure still points to a higher low, keeping the bullish trend intact while awaiting confirmation.

If Bitcoin holds above $66,500 and volume strengthens, the next upside target sits around $73,000 to $75,000. Tesla’s decision to maintain its position also removes the risk of another large corporate sale. That does not guarantee higher prices, but it keeps supply pressure from increasing.

On the other hand, the base case still favors sideways trading between $62,000 and $70,000 as traders digest macro developments. However, a daily close below $60,000 could reopen the $55,000 to $58,000 support zone. Long periods of low volatility often end with a decisive move, although the direction remains uncertain.

Tesla’s Bitcoin position, now worth roughly $765 million at current prices, remains a useful market signal rather than a direct catalyst. Holding through a sharp quarterly decline shows the company was unwilling to sell into weakness. That steady approach could help support market confidence if institutional demand continues to build.
